महाभारतः       mahābhārataḥ - book-4, chapter-44, verse-13

अथ वा कुञ्जरं मत्तमेक एव चरन्वने ।
अनङ्कुशं समारुह्य नगरं गन्तुमिच्छसि ॥१३॥
13. atha vā kuñjaraṁ mattameka eva caranvane ,
anaṅkuśaṁ samāruhya nagaraṁ gantumicchasi.
13. atha vā kuñjaram mattam ekaḥ eva caran vane
| anaṅkuśam samāruhya nagaram gantum icchasi
13. Or else, wandering alone in the forest, you desire to ride an un-goaded mad elephant into the city.

Words meanings and morphology

अथ (atha) - or else (now, then, thereupon, or)
(indeclinable)
वा (vā) - or, optionally
(indeclinable)
कुञ्जरम् (kuñjaram) - an elephant
(noun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of kuñjara
kuñjara - elephant
मत्तम् (mattam) - mad (elephant) (mad, intoxicated, excited)
(adjective)
Accusative, masculine, singular of matta
matta - mad, intoxicated, excited, furious
Past Passive Participle
From root √mad (to be drunk, to be mad)
Root: mad (class 4)
Note: Agrees with kuñjaram
एकः (ekaḥ) - one, alone
(numeral)
एव (eva) - alone, by oneself (only, just, indeed)
(indeclinable)
चरन् (caran) - wandering, moving, walking
(participle)
Nominative, masculine, singular of carant
carant - walking, moving, wandering
Present Active Participle
From root √car (to move, to walk, to wander)
Root: car (class 1)
वने (vane) - in the forest, in a grove
(noun)
Locative, neuter, singular of vana
vana - forest, wood, grove
अनङ्कुशम् (anaṅkuśam) - an un-goaded (elephant) (without a goad, uncontrolled)
(adjective)
Accusative, masculine, singular of anaṅkuśa
anaṅkuśa - without a goad, uncontrolled, unbridled
Compound type : nañ-bahuvrīhi (an+aṅkuśa)
  • an – not, non-
    indeclinable
  • aṅkuśa – goad (for elephants)
    noun (masculine)
Note: Agrees with kuñjaram
समारुह्य (samāruhya) - having mounted, having ascended
(indeclinable)
absolutive (gerund)
Derived from root √ruh (to rise, to grow) with prefixes sam (together, well) and ā (towards, up), and suffix -ya
Prefixes: sam+ā
Root: ruh (class 1)
नगरम् (nagaram) - to the city, a city
(noun)
Accusative, neuter, singular of nagara
nagara - city, town
गन्तुम् (gantum) - to go, to move
(indeclinable)
infinitive
Infinitive of root √gam (to go)
Root: gam (class 1)
इच्छसि (icchasi) - you wish, you desire, you want
(verb)
2nd person , singular, active, present indicative (lat) of √iṣ
Present Indicative
From the desiderative stem of √iṣ, 'iccha'
Root: iṣ (class 6)
